2024 Chevy Silverado EV Trail Boss Takes the Electric Pickup Off Road

  • The 2024 Chevrolet Silverado EV will have an off-road-oriented Trail Boss model like the gas-powered truck.

  • Expect all-terrain tires, locking differentials, and possibly the GMC Hummer EV's Crab Walk feature.

  • The Silverado EV will arrive in 2023 and the Trail Boss should follow after the RST which arrives in the fall.

Chevrolet's new Silverado EV electric pickup was just revealed, and it has something the Ford F-150 Lightning does not yet offer: an off-road-oriented version. Like the gas-powered Silverado, the Silverado EV will have a Trail Boss off-road model.

Chevrolet won't spill any additional details on the Silverado EV Trail Boss other than what's pictured above, which shows that it will have matte black body cladding and red tow hooks on the front end. The Silverado EV is available with 24-inch wheels, but the Trail Boss will have smaller, unique black wheels on all-terrain tires. Expect a lifted suspension, standard air springs, locking differentials (the GMC Hummer EV has two electric motors on the rear axle that can mimic a locking diff and a locker on the front axle), and it could possibly get the Hummer EV's Crab Walk feature, too.
